From: Hans Holmberg Date: Fri, 31 Oct 2025 08:29:48 +0000 (+0100) Subject: xfs: remove xarray mark for reclaimable zones X-Git-Tag: v6.19-rc1~164^2~4 X-Git-Url: http://git.ipfire.org/cgi-bin/gitweb.cgi?a=commitdiff_plain;h=bf3b8e915215ef78319b896c0ccc14dc57dac80f;p=thirdparty%2Fkernel%2Flinux.git xfs: remove xarray mark for reclaimable zones We can easily check if there are any reclaimble zones by just looking at the used counters in the reclaim buckets, so do that to free up the xarray mark we currently use for this purpose.
